Videos with tag epcot
Results 1-1 of 1

YOUR TRAVEL GUIDE -- Disney's EPCOT Center, Orlando, FL

Kate visits futuristic EPCOT.

Channels: Travel & Places 

Added: 5044 days ago by blogpost_biz

Runtime: 01:00 | Views: 687 | Comments: 0

Not yet rated